During the tour you will have a chance to visit the twenty historic chambers connected by approximately 1.25 miles (2 kilometers) of passages. Descent into the mine is by staircase (380 steps) to the 1st Level (at a depth of 110 feet or 64 metres) and return to the surface is by lift up the Danilowicz shaft from the 3rd Level (at a depth of 443 feet or 135 meters). The whole tour lasts about 4-5 hours. You will spend around 2 hours in the Salt Mine.

    Wieliczka Salt Mine

    The Wieliczka Salt Mine is on UNESCO's 1st World List of Cultural and Natural Heritage due to its' importance in the history of mining. The mine is also notable for a long tradition of tourism. This famous breath-taking site has been visited over the centuries by Nicolaus Copernicus, Johann Wolfgang von Goethe, Alexander von Humboldt, Dimitri Mendeleev, Boleslaw Prus, Ignacy Paderewski, Pope John Paul II, and crowned heads of state, not to mention millions of people from all over the world. Included in the tour is a stunning "underground town" with lakes, passages, and the marvelous Saint Kinga Chapel. The whole tour lasts about 4-5 hours. You will spend around 2 hours in the Salt Mine.
